Course Content

• Introduction to Economic Nationalism: Theories and History
• Protectionism and Trade Barriers: Tariffs, Quotas, and Non-Tariff Barriers
• The Economics of Globalization and its Critics: Analyzing the Impact of Free Trade
• Strategic Industries and Industrial Policy: Fostering National Competitiveness
• State Intervention and Market Regulation: Balancing Economic Growth with Social Goals
• International Trade Agreements and Negotiations: Navigating Global Trade Rules
• Economic Nationalism and National Security: Protecting Critical Infrastructure
• Case Studies in Economic Nationalism: Successes, Failures, and Lessons Learned
